Hello all
I have removed VAT from the website by
1.) disabling it in Settings > options
2.) setting the tax class to zero
3.) Disabling in Order Totals also
The website now, still removes 20% from the products.
My website is http://puchipetwear.com/
The products on the homepage, or the first one, has the price at £29.17 when in the back office for the product it is £35.
Am i missing something?

Taxes are always added on top of prices in OpenCart, so my guess is that you have a mod installed that was taking the product price and assuming it was the taxed cost. Thus, it's taking the cost out when displaying it. Look into the mods you've installed, and see if you can find any that are designed to change the product price.

None of those seem like they would interfere, though I'm not familiar with all of them.
I'd suggest to double-check your vqmods as well, if you have any. Those would be in /vqmod/xml/ on your server. Some extensions have both a vQmod file and an admin panel interface, but some only have the vQmod file, so it may not show up anywhere in your admin panel.
If you can't find anything there, you may need to hire someone to take a look at the issue more in depth for you. I just deleted all the files in /vqmod/xml/ and the prices stayed the same. Any other suggestions?
Most likely, this means the mod is hard-coded. You'll probably need to hire someone to search through the relevant files and find the code, then disable it.
It also *could* be a 1.5.2 bug, though I don't really think that's the case. I just tested in my localhost 1.5.2 store and it didn't have that issue, but it may be something internal to OpenCart. To fix that you'd need to search the 1.5.2 bug topic (if there is one) or set up a default 1.5.2 installation and see if it exhibits the same issue. You could also try updating to OpenCart 1.5.6.4, which may solve the issue.
